]> git.lizzy.rs Git - irrlicht.git/commitdiff
Use qualifed id instead of virtual function calls in CVertexBuffer constructors
authorcutealien <cutealien@dfc29bdd-3216-0410-991c-e03cc46cb475>
Thu, 19 Jan 2023 23:26:20 +0000 (23:26 +0000)
committersfan5 <sfan5@live.de>
Fri, 24 Mar 2023 16:09:11 +0000 (17:09 +0100)
Another find by cppcheck tool

git-svn-id: svn://svn.code.sf.net/p/irrlicht/code/trunk@6448 dfc29bdd-3216-0410-991c-e03cc46cb475

include/CVertexBuffer.h

index aa8049f31a0e1bfb8c7398358042708af04cc770..7a913505744de3c6a32c12c0fe19d859baefa6ed 100644 (file)
@@ -75,18 +75,18 @@ namespace scene
                CVertexBuffer(video::E_VERTEX_TYPE vertexType) : Vertices(0),\r
                                MappingHint(EHM_NEVER), ChangedID(1)\r
                {\r
-                       setType(vertexType);\r
+                       CVertexBuffer::setType(vertexType);\r
                }\r
 \r
                CVertexBuffer(const IVertexBuffer &VertexBufferCopy) :\r
                                Vertices(0), MappingHint(EHM_NEVER),\r
                                ChangedID(1)\r
                {\r
-                       setType(VertexBufferCopy.getType());\r
-                       reallocate(VertexBufferCopy.size());\r
+                       CVertexBuffer::setType(VertexBufferCopy.getType());\r
+                       CVertexBuffer::reallocate(VertexBufferCopy.size());\r
 \r
                        for (u32 n=0;n<VertexBufferCopy.size();++n)\r
-                               push_back(VertexBufferCopy[n]);\r
+                               CVertexBuffer::push_back(VertexBufferCopy[n]);\r
                }\r
 \r
                virtual ~CVertexBuffer()\r